Just had 6 tons of uae buckewheat dropped in the driveway friday afternoon. with this delivery I am up to 10 ton stocked piled at my house. I am working on making a second coal bin in the basement that will hold another 6 or 7 tons and I will fill that as well.
I will be burning the efm 520 all yr around again barring any problems.
for me and my family coal has been a huge savings for us over oil. even if oil is cheaper to use in the summer -which im not sure it is, my wife and kids don't like the hot water capacity of oil. the coal makes great hot water and lots of it.
the wife is already looking forward to cold weather to feel the heat and warm that the stoker supplies.
